Xi'An Aircraft Industrial Corporation Ma60 (MA60)

The Xi'an MA60 is a Chinese twin-turboprop regional airliner developed in the early 2000s as a modernized derivative of the Shaanxi Y-7, itself a licensed copy of the Soviet Antonov An-24. Manufactured by Xi'an Aircraft Industrial Corporation (XAC), the MA60 entered service in 2005 and represents China's effort to compete in the 50-60 seat regional market dominated by Western manufacturers like ATR and Bombardier. The aircraft features Pratt & Whitney Canada PW127J engines, a glass cockpit, and improved passenger amenities compared to its Cold War-era ancestor, though it retains the high-wing configuration and rugged short-field capability of the An-24 family. The MA60 has found its primary market in developing nations across Africa, Asia, and the Pacific, where its ability to operate from unpaved or short runways and its relatively low acquisition cost make it attractive for regional connectivity. However, the type has faced challenges in gaining broader international acceptance, with several high-profile incidents and concerns about maintenance support limiting its adoption. Maximum takeoff weight is 47,400 pounds, with a typical cruise speed around 280 knots and range of approximately 800 nautical miles with full payload. The aircraft's approach speed of roughly 110 knots and stall speeds in the low 80-90 knot range reflect its short-field design philosophy. Despite limited Western market penetration, the MA60 remains in production and continues to serve niche routes where its operational economics and field performance outweigh concerns about parts availability and regulatory acceptance. Safety in context

The incident rate counts flights with ANY safety event detected by SkyMeter — go-arounds (a routine response, not a failure), unstable-approach gate flags (advisory thresholds), rejected takeoffs (the system working as designed), and runway events. It is NOT an accident rate or fatality rate. For accident statistics, refer to the NTSB Aviation Accident Database (USA) or the Aviation Safety Network.
